Jaren Jackson Jr. named 2022-23 Kia NBA Defensive Player of the Year

The Memphis big man was announced Monday night as the recipient of the Hakeem Olajuwon Trophy as the 2022-23 Kia NBA Defensive Player of the Year, becoming the second player to win the award while wearing a Grizzlies’ uniform.

He got 56 first-place votes and 391 voting points to finish ahead of runner-up Brook Lopez of the Milwaukee Bucks, who got 31 first-place votes and 309 points.

Even though he’s always been a shot-blocker – he’s swatted 1.8 per game throughout his career – this was the first time that Lopez was a serious candidate for the DPOY award.
